Different Types of Portable Grills

There are going to be two main types of portable grills.  Those are either a portable propane gas grill or a portable charcoal grill.  To clarify what makes a grill ‘portable’, it is the fact that it needs to weigh less than 50 pounds or so and be on the easier side when it comes to transporting it (meaning that one person is going to be able to carry the entire thing up and down some stairs).  While which type of portable grill is going to vary depending upon who you speak with about it, this article is going to focus only on portable propane grills.  With that being said, here is everything that you need to know about purchasing a portable propane grill.

Your Grills Portability

When you are shopping for a propane grill, the first thing you are going to need to keep in mind is how much you are going to be willing to push, pull or carry around.  The last thing you want to do with your portable grill is to leave it behind because it is too heavy or cumbersome for you to transport or carry.  They average portable propane grill is going to weight anywhere between 10 and 57 pounds, so be sure that you know what your own limitations are and purchase a grill that you will have no problems maneuvering around.  With that being said, there are going to be two different types of grills for you to consider, those being either a cart style grill that will have two wheels attached to it or a tabletop grill.  While they both have their pros and cons, it is ultimately up to you which style you choose.

The Grills Surface Area

Once you know the style of grill you are going to get, the next most important thing to consider is how much cooking surface area you are going to require.  Are you planning to cook for larger groups of people or just you and your family?  Are you only grilling meat or are you going to be grilling vegetables at the same time?  Each of these questions is going to require a different amount of grilling surface area.  Just be sure that you consider this important factor when you are shopping for your portable grill.

Your Grill’s Cooking Performance

Your grill’s cooking performance is going to be very important once you factor in your diet, cooking style and the foods that you are planning to cook.  For example, if you are going to be using your grill for mainly hamburgers and hot dogs, any kind of grill is going to suffice.  But if you are planning on using it to cook some more elaborate meals or maybe even for smoking, you are going to want a grill that will provide you with a much more sophisticated performance.  Some of the performance features you will want to keep in mind when searching for your perfect portable propane grill include:

  • BTU output
  • Burner control
  • Wind resistance
  • Additional added features
